Lady Cougar soccer gets team effort in 2-0 win over Allen

The Barton Community College women's soccer team won today at Cougar Field 2-0 against Allen Community College.   The Lady Cougars improve to 8-6-1 on the season while remaining tied for fourth place at 7-3 with just two games remaining.  Barton concludes their regular season home schedule this Friday at Cougar Field in a 4:00 p.m. kick-off against No. 11 nationally ranked Butler Community College

The Lady Cougars got on the scoreboard with just under seventeen minutes remaining in the first half as Jennifer Allende followed a missed shot which gave Barton the lead it would carry into halftime.   Monica McCarthy sealed the victory with four minutes remaining in the second half as she too followed a Cougar missed shot. 

“I was proud of the girls effort today,” said Barton Women’s Soccer Head Coach Shawn Uhlenhake. “Back to back games are difficult and to come away with a win today is great.  “Everyone is contributing and we are playing like a team.”
